Procedure Enhancement Explained: Stages & Techniques

Workflow optimization is the method of reviewing existing workflows to pinpoint areas for improvement. It's about making things better and minimizing inefficiencies. The common phases involved often comprise mapping the current workflow, evaluating its effectiveness, identifying limitations, designing alternatives, and then executing and observing the modifications. Several methodologies can be used, such as Lean, Kaizen, and Business Mapping.

  • Lean emphasizes eliminating unnecessary steps.
  • Kaizen is an cyclical cycle for continuous improvement.
  • Business Mapping requires a radical re-evaluation of workflows.

Demystifying Process Improvement: Key Concepts You Need to Know

Understanding task enhancement doesn’t have to be a intricate endeavor. At its core, it's about building things more effective. Key principles feature identifying constraints – areas where work slows down – and then executing changes to eliminate redundancy. You'll encounter terms like streamlining, which highlights minimizing superfluous steps, and Six Sigma, a data-driven system for reducing errors in a system. Basically, it’s about a constant cycle of assessment and adjustment to drive superior results.
